freeCodeCamp/controllers/course.js

22 lines
478 B
JavaScript
Raw Normal View History

2014-10-16 16:07:06 +00:00
/**
* GET /
* Home page.
*/
2014-10-16 23:18:26 +00:00
var Course = require('./../models/Course')
2014-10-16 16:07:06 +00:00
exports.index = function(req, res) {
2014-10-16 23:18:26 +00:00
Course.find(function(err, courses){
2014-10-17 00:04:28 +00:00
res.render('course/index', {
title: 'Courses',
2014-10-16 23:18:26 +00:00
courses: courses
});
2014-10-16 16:07:06 +00:00
});
2014-10-16 23:18:26 +00:00
};
2014-10-17 00:04:28 +00:00
exports.view = function(req, res) {
Course.findById(req.param.id, function(err, course){
res.render('course/view', {
title: 'Course',
course: course
});
});
};